Concord University hosts conference to prevent child abuse

Child abuse is the number one killer of children in America, but according to the U.S Department of Justice, only about one in three is reported to authorities.

Social workers and other professionals who work with children gathered Wednesday at Concord University to learn more about recognizing and responding to child abuse.

It has long been reported that most abusive parents or guardians were at one time abused themselves, but disturbing new trends indicate that more children than we realize are being victimized.

"We are also talking a lot today about how children experience abuse, the emotional effect, and also the neurological and the brain development of a child who has been abused and how that is different from a child who is not abused," says Shiloh Woodard from Child Protective Services of Mercer County.

National statistics indicate that more then half of all sexually abused children in the United States are under twelve years of age.
